Thomas Franklin Key, a longtime resident of Llano County, Texas, passed away May 15, 2013, at the age of 77. He was born to Josie Debra (Allen) and James Hilton Key on June 6, 1935, in San Saba County at his home on the Barnes Ranch.

He was a member of Llano First Baptist Church and loved listening to gospel and old country music.

Thomas is survived by sisters Ada Ruth Mallett of Burnet and Joan Oestreich and Joyce Staats, both of Llano; numerous nieces and nephews; and a host of friends.

Thomas was preceded in death by his parents and sister Imogene Cook.

A funeral service was May 18 at First Baptist Church in Llano with the Rev. Rick Cundieff officiating. Burial followed at Tow Cemetery. Pallbearers were members of his Sunday school class. Lee Duncan was honorary pallbearer.
